Cannot wait: Katie Taylor says undisputed title victory would surpass Olympic Gold medal achievement




Katie Taylor has said she cannot wait for Saturday’s showdown with Delfine Persoon, and has stated that a win in her lightweight unification fight would be a better achievement than her heroics at the London Olympics in 2012.

Taylor who has the chance to become the first ever Irish person to win all four titles in the division, told Sky Sports that Saturday’s fight is the fight she always wanted.

Although the Bray native admits the fight is the most difficult she has faced, she said she is ready for the challenge.

Taylor who was full of admiration for her opponent told the broadcaster that she wants to make history and to become undisputed champion is the pinnacle of boxing and to secure a victory would surpass her Gold medal achievement at the 2012 Olympic Games.

Taylor’s comments comes ahead of a bumper night of boxing this Saturday as Britain’s Anthony Joshua is set to defend his heavyweight title against Andy Ruiz Junior, in Madison Square Garden.

All the action on a stacked undercard is expected to get underway at 10pm this Saturday June 1st, on Sky Sports Box Office.
